Web/eCommerce Product Manager - Kforce Inc.
Dubuque, IA 52001
About the Job
- Working with the Senior Product manager, Development teams and key business stakeholders to define and execute the vision for the web/eCommerce experience
- Supporting a product roadmap and managing a backlog in execution of this vision
- Collaborating with partners and with external vendors to understand business needs and opportunities and translate them into features and enhancements
- Partnering with engineering and systems owners to effectively execute against product roadmap and vision
- Building a web/ecomm program that uses data and measurement to ensure accountability to outcomes, impact, and ROI
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in related field or equivalent experience
- 5+ years of applicable experience
- 5-8 years of experience in a product owner or product development role
- Knowledge of Scrum and Agile
- Excellent knowledge of user-centered design principles and design quality standards
- Proficiency in the use of analytic tools
- Excellent oral and written communication
- Strong project management skills, ability to juggle multiple projects and work with a variety of stakeholders and teams, including business and engineering teams
- Comfortable handling multiple tasks and switching priorities and focus areas as needed
- Creative and customer-focused
- Familiarity with web and ecomm standards and best practices, including privacy compliance and accessibility principles, practices, and testing
- Ability to prioritize effectively
- Requires up to 25% of travel
